Transaction 38c2656f6d0cfb46e31e6f87856acc4fc120e3b0af3fbe70e7da9f050770ed2b
1 Input
1 Output
-
38c2656f6d0cfb46e31e6f87856acc4fc120e3b0af3fbe70e7da9f050770ed2b:0
- value
- 168688
- script pubkey
- OP_0 OP_PUSHBYTES_20 87e6367ecd029c7476de1492f4f861ea9387201d
- address
- bc1qslnrvlkdq2w8gak7zjf0f7rpa2fcwgqavpn3ah